Lacrimal artery logo #21000 The lacrimal artery arises close to the optic foramen, and is one of the largest branches derived from the ophthalmic artery: not infrequently it is given off before the artery enters the orbit. lacrimal artery logo #21001origin, ophthalmic artery; branches, lateral palpebral arteries and a branch joining with middle meningeal artery; distribution, lacrimal gland, upper and lower eyelids, conjunctiva.
